Early Life and Family Roots

Isiah Pacheco’s journey began in Vineland, New Jersey, a place that provided the foundation for his burgeoning athletic career and shaped his character. Growing up in a close-knit family environment, he learned the importance of hard work, perseverance, and unwavering loyalty, values that would later define his approach to football and life. He wasn’t alone; he grew up surrounded by siblings and was the seventh of nine children. The dynamic within the Pacheco household was one of warmth, encouragement, and a shared commitment to overcoming challenges together. While Isiah’s talent on the football field was evident from a young age, it was the support and encouragement of his parents, Edwin and Felicia, that truly fueled his passion. Edwin Pacheco was a jack of all trades, working multiple jobs to support his family, his work ethic was later passed on to Isiah. Isiah shared a unique bond with his father, who consistently offered him encouragement and motivation to aim for greatness.

The Heartbreaking Loss of His Mother

In 2016, Isiah Pacheco’s life was forever altered by the devastating loss of his mother, Felicia Pacheco. After a battle with cancer, Felicia passed away, leaving a void that seemed impossible to fill. For Isiah, who was just beginning to navigate the complexities of adolescence, the loss was particularly profound. Felicia wasn’t just a mother; she was his confidante, his biggest cheerleader, and a constant source of unconditional love. She was always front row to his games. The news of her passing was the first of tragedies to hit the Pacheco family. Dealing with grief and navigating the emotional turmoil that followed was undoubtedly one of the most challenging periods of his life.

However, amid the pain, Isiah found strength in the memories of his mother’s unwavering spirit and the lessons she had instilled in him. He remembered her constant encouragement, her belief in his abilities, and her insistence that he never give up, no matter the obstacles he faced. He would find comfort in her words and promised himself to continue the values she shared with him.

The Second Blow: Loss of His Father

Just a year after losing his mother, Isiah Pacheco was struck by another devastating blow: the passing of his father, Edwin Pacheco, in 2017. Overcome with the grief and confusion, Isiah struggled to comprehend the tragedies. Edwin Pacheco was the anchor of the family, a provider, and a source of unwavering support for Isiah’s athletic aspirations. Losing both parents in such quick succession left Isiah reeling and questioning his path forward. The emotional toll was immense, and he grappled with feelings of isolation, despair, and uncertainty about the future.

Yet, even in the darkest of times, Isiah found a flicker of hope and resilience within himself. He knew that his parents would want him to persevere, to continue pursuing his dreams, and to honor their memory by living a life filled with purpose and determination. His love for football was one of the main sources that helped him keep going. Pacheco was a star running back for Vineland High School and was one of the most highly sought-after recruits in the state of New Jersey. The pressure of high school football helped him focus on improving himself as an athlete, all while grieving the loss of his parents. Isiah later committed to playing football at Rutgers University and moved away from Vineland.
